The organization of the National Sports Week (PON) in Aceh and North Sumatra in 2024 is expected to have a significant impact on the tourism sector, particularly in increasing hotel occupancy in Medan. This article explores the role of tourism communication, supporting factors, and the effects of this major event on the tourism industry. Using qualitative research methods and secondary data analysis, it is found that effective tourism communication, including promotions through social media and collaboration influencers, can attract visitors' attention. Collaboration among the government, hospitality industry players, and travel agents is also crucial for disseminating accurate information regarding available facilities and tour packages. The findings indicate that PON XXI has the potential to increase both visitor numbers and hotel occupancy during and after the event. Furthermore, hotel managers in Medan are advised to develop sustainable communication strategies to promote the city as an attractive tourist destination, thereby providing long-term positive impacts on regional tourism. With a well-planned approach, Medan can maximize its tourism potential and leverage the momentum of PON XXI to attract more tourists in the future.
